Will my toe tattoo hurt?

While getting a toe tattoo can be a unique and exciting experience, it’s essential to consider the level of pain involved. The degree of discomfort depends on several factors, including the size and intricacy of the design, as well as your personal tolerance for pain. Smaller tattoos typically require fewer needles and shorter sessions, making them less painful overall. However, tattoos on thinner skin areas, like the toes, can be more agonizing than those on thicker skin regions.

If you’re concerned about the level of pain or have questions, it’s best to consult with your tattoo artist. They may offer valuable insights on how to minimize discomfort during and after the procedure.

How much does a toe tattoo cost?

When it comes to getting a toe tattoo, the cost is influenced by several factors – the size and intricacy of the design, as well as the studio you choose. While smaller tattoos tend to be more affordable than larger ones, this isn’t always the case. To get an accurate estimate, it’s best to consult with your artist directly. Furthermore, many studios offer promotions or discounts on specific types of designs or sizes, so don’t hesitate to inquire about these when weighing your options.

What are some common toe tattoo designs?

When it comes to toe tattoo designs, people often opt for creative and personalized options that reflect their individuality. Among the most popular choices are floral patterns, animals, words or phrases, and abstract art, which can add visual interest and meaning to the design. Some individuals prefer simpler, more minimalist approaches, such as dots or lines that highlight the natural shape of their toes.

Moreover, many talented artists specialize in crafting custom designs that cater to a person’s unique style, body type, and personal preferences. For those seeking a truly one-of-a-kind tattoo experience, discussing custom design options with an artist can be an excellent way to ensure your final product is a perfect reflection of who you are.
